Abstract:

The EU Network of Excellence ALTER-Net (http://www.alter-net.info/) aims at improving and linking the management of the diversity of plants, animals and habitats. ALTER-Net consists of 24 research institutions in 17 countries. Within RA 5 we conduct case studies (a pilot survey) in eight European countries on the perception of biodiversity by residents, in particular their perceptions of observed changes in nature and loss of endangered species and habitats as well as their opinions towards conservation measures. In Austria, the case study region is covered by the Long Term Socio-Ecological Research (LSTER) site Eisenwurzen, which is coordinated by the project partner Federal Environment Agency (UBA). In particular, we address the following questions:

- What are the values of nature for residents (distinguishing rural, semi-urban, urban)?

- Which changes are observed, which are perceived as important by people?

- From the people’s standpoint: which institutions should act to halt degradation? Which measures are adequate?

- Which socio-economic factors inform environmental awareness and environmentally conscious behaviour?

- Which differences exist across countries?
